    Advertising can be split into two types , indirect and direct.

    Indirect advertising is where someone has for example a CSGO Gambling site in their name , this really doesn't deserve a straight permanent ban as they are not directly telling people to check out the site and it doesn't really have an effect on the server as it is not a Garry's Mod community. A simple warn and kick can do the job for this , a ban if necessary.

    What you are talking about is when someone comes on the server and has no intention to play on the server and only wants to advertise their own server for their own benefit. So for example someone joins and says "Join ******* it's the best garry's mod server" blah blah blah. That's directly telling people to join their server and this I agree would warrant a permanent ban.
